In 2013, a CNN program that featured Charlotte’s Web cannabis brought increased attention to the use of CBD in the treatment of seizure disorders. Since then, 16 states have passed laws to allow the use of CBD products with a physician’s recommendation for treatment of certain medical conditions. This is in addition to the 30 states that have passed comprehensive medical cannabis laws, which allow for the use of cannabis products with no restrictions on THC content.

The Colorado Industrial Hemp Program registers growers of industrial hemp and samples crops to verify that the dry-weight THC concentration does not exceed 0.3%. While the Farm Bill that legislators signed into law in December legalizes hemp, the FDA was quick to remind people that that doesn’t mean CBD products can now be sold freely. The FDA has many times issued warnings about CBD products and companies making unfounded health claims.
